- [ ] Step 7: Archive cold storage buckets (Glacierline tier). Confirm both ceremony witnesses are present, verify bucket manifests match the Oxbow ledger, then seal the archive key shares. Plugin authors may observe but not handle shares. Once sealed, the archive index itself is encrypted and can only be reopened with the passphrase below.

vault phrase of badup-hahig = tamael-aldael-kelmir-istael-fenok-istwyn-tamius-jorath-oliion

## Formula sandbox tuning

User-supplied formulas in Gridmoor execute inside a restricted interpreter with hard ceilings on time, memory, and call depth. Reviewers should confirm any change to these ceilings is justified in the PR description, since raising them widens the abuse surface. Defaults were chosen from production traces. The current limits are as follows.

limits module of tafog-fawip:
WEIGHTS = {
    "julix": 57,
    "lamys": 992,
    "kasvan": 209,
    "quenok": 750,
    "alddor": 259,
    "oliath": 1009,
    "wenix": 815,
}

WEEKLY OFF-SITE RUN — CHECKLIST ITEM 6: CASH-BOX

Every Thursday before 11:00, the sealed cash-box from the Lanmere Road kiosk goes out with the scheduled Corvette Couriers pickup. Confirm the tamper strip is intact and the weight matches the log sheet kept at the dispatch desk. The box rides in the lockable pannier, never loose in the van. Sign the transfer sheet in two places, keep the pink copy, and file it same day. When the courier arrives, pass on this instruction verbatim:

handover note for hafop-yageg: the soriel tamys courier leaves the tamdor quenok aldvan ledger at gate 5357 under passcode 293424